Grammar compatibility (AX plan Phase 5): does candidate grammar B still accept what baseline A accepted, and does it build the same tree for inputs both accept? Returns EVIDENCE AND CONFIDENCE, never a bare verdict: {normalForm, proven[], observed[], changes[], counterexamples[], confidence, why}. confidence:'low' with a stated reason is a successful run, not a failure — language inclusion is undecidable in general, so anything outside the decidable subset is reported not-proven rather than incompatible. Supply `corpus` (real inputs) for the tier that measures what your documents actually do.
